Given a stream of integers and a window size, calculate the moving average of all integers in the sliding window.
For example,
MovingAverage m = new MovingAverage(3); m.next(1) = 1 m.next(10) = (1 + 10) / 2 m.next(3) = (1 + 10 + 3) / 3 m.next(5) = (10 + 3 + 5) / 3
class MovingAverage {
Queue<Integer> s = new LinkedList<Integer>();
double d = 0;
int xsize;
/** Initialize your data structure here. */
public MovingAverage(int size) {
xsize = size;
}
public double next(int val) {
d += val;
if(s.size()>= xsize){
d -= (double)s.poll();
}
s.add(val);
return d/s.size();
}
}
